ABSTRACT
Human adenovirus(HAdV)is a double-stranded DNA virus with multiple serotypes.Owing to their genetic heterogeneity, HAdVs display broad tissue tropism and can infect several organs or tissues.Besides the most common respiratory system, different types of HAdV can enter into multi-tissue and cells of the whole body through different receptors and mechanisms, directly destroy the host cells and also trigger immune response that course further damages.Then a variety of extrapulmonary manifestations would appear, such as gastroenteritis, encephalitis, myocarditis, hemorrhagic cystitis, hemophagocytosis and conjunctivitis, which seriously threaten the health of children.
